
'Jeopardy!' host Ken Jennings slammed by 'Big Bang Theory' star for crossing the picket line
Fox News
Ken Jennings' decision to continue to host "Jeopardy!" amid the writers strike was criticized by actor Wil Wheaton. Mayim Bialik stepped away from her duties in solidarity.
"This is a VERY small town, Ken Jennings, and we will all remember this," he wrote. "Your privilege may protect you right now, but we will *never* forget."
He continued to share his thoughts in the comments section writing, "Hey y’all, if you’re here to s--- on unions, you can f--- right off. I’ve been a union man since I was a union boy, and I will be a union man until the day I die. If you're here to s--- on the workers of the world, or to make excuses for someone who is currently doing that, go f--- yourself and don't come back."
